Problems solved by technology

[0004] Although the traditional wind power generation device can effectively utilize wind energy, due to its large size, it can only be blown when the wind reaches a certain intensity, but it cannot be effectively utilized when the wind is weak. In addition, the blades on the existing wind power generation device can blow the fan blades to rotate when encountering a downwind, but will resist the rotation of the fan blades when encountering a headwind, and there is no corresponding mechanism that can increase or reduce wind resistance. equipment, which sometimes hinders the rotation of the wind power generation device, so a wind power generation device that uses the rotational force to increase the wind volume came into being

Abstract

The invention relates to the technical field of wind power generation, and discloses wind power generation equipment capable of increasing wind quantity by utilizing rotating force. The wind power generation equipment comprises a vertical rod, wherein the surface of the vertical rod is movably connected with a rotating shaft, the surface of the rotating shaft is sleeved with a shaft sleeve, the surface of the shaft sleeve is fixedly connected with blades, the blades are internally provided with connecting rods, the surfaces of the connecting rods are fixedly connected with gears, the surfacesof the gears are meshed with rotating bodies, the inner portion of the rotating bodies are movably connected with deflection wheels, and the surfaces of the rotating bodies are fixedly connected withdamping plates. According to the wind power generation equipment, wind direction plates are pushed to expand towards the two sides, as shown in the figure 5, when the blades rotate to the air-free surface, the position of the rotating bodies and the wind direction plates is unchanged, at the moment, the wind direction plates lose the force of wind blowing, the force of blowing air before releasingbegins to be released, namely a force pushing the blades to rotate is generated, in the releasing process, and the wind direction plates lose the supporting force of inflating rods to begin to contract, and as shown in the figure 7, so that the effect of increasing the rotating force of the driving blades is achieved.
